An efficient synthesis of novel -aminophosphonates by the reaction of quino[2,3-b][1,5]benzoxazepines with triethyl phosphite in the presence of the easily available, inexpensive, and nontoxic catalyst p-toluene sulphonic acid (p-TSA). This method affords the -aminophosphonates under the influence of ultrasound irradiation in solvent-free conditions, in short reaction times (4-6 min), high yields (80-90%), with improved purity. The synthesized -aminophosphonates show antibacterial activity against Gram-positive and Gram-negative bacteria. Supplemental materials are available for this article.
